WebAppa lachian Joy is a white flowering dogwood cultivar with Supernumerary bracts isolated from a field planting of approximately 1,100,000 Cornus florida seedlings in Decherd, Tenn. Seeds in this field were bulked from collec tions of wild and landscape trees growing in Tennessee, North Carolina, Alabama and Georgia.

Design and … WebJul 2, 2015 · Jean's Appalachian Snow Dogwood. A small tree with large, white bracts in spring. Medium green foliage turns red in the fall. It is resistant to powdery mildew. Prefers partial sun, and a site with good soil drainage and reliable summer moisture. Introduced by the Tennessee Agricultural Experiment Station in 1998. PP 13,099.
